What are 2 examples contact forces?

Examples of contact forces include:

  • Reaction force. An object at rest on a surface experiences reaction force .
  • Tension. An object that is being stretched experiences a tension force.
  • Friction. Two objects sliding past each other experience friction forces.

How do you find the contact force between two objects?

How to Calculate Contact Force

  1. Step 1: Determine the Frictional Force.
  2. Step 2: Determine the Normal Force.
  3. Step 3: Apply the Pythagorean Theorem to Determine the Magnitude of the Overall Contact Force.

Is gravity a contact force?

Gravitational force is an example of a non-contact force.

How does the Spatial contact force block work?

The Spatial Contact Force block models forces between base and follower frame solid bodies. When the two solid blocks are connected, the Spatial Contact Force block applies equal and opposite forces along a common contact plane. These forces conform to Newton’s Third Law.
